Top Contenders: Electric Bikes with Superior Battery Performance:
Several electric bikes stand out in the market for their superior battery performance, offering exceptional range, reliability, and overall efficiency. The Specialized Turbo Vado series is renowned for its powerful lithium-ion batteries, providing up to 80 miles of range on a single charge. These bikes feature advanced battery management systems that optimize power usage and extend battery life, making them a top choice for commuters and long-distance riders.
Another notable contender is the Rad Power Bikes RadCity 5 Plus, equipped with a 672Wh battery that delivers impressive range and performance. Its battery is easily removable, allowing for convenient charging and the option to carry a spare for extended trips. Rad Power Bikes also offers a robust support network, ensuring users have access to replacement batteries and maintenance services.
The Riese & Müller Supercharger series takes battery performance to the next level with its dual battery option, combining two powerful batteries for an extraordinary range of up to 100 miles. This setup is ideal for long-distance touring and heavy-duty commuting, providing consistent power and reducing the need for frequent recharges.
The Trek Allant+ 9.9S is another high-performing e-bike, featuring a 625Wh Bosch PowerTube battery integrated seamlessly into the frame. This bike offers a sleek design and extended range, making it perfect for riders who demand both style and substance.
These top contenders exemplify the advancements in e-bike battery technology, offering riders reliable power, extended range, and the convenience of modern features, ensuring an exceptional riding experience.
Evaluating Battery Capacity and Range:
Evaluating battery capacity and range is crucial when choosing an electric bike, as these factors directly impact your riding experience. Battery capacity, measured in watt-hours (Wh), indicates the amount of energy the battery can store. A higher capacity typically translates to a longer range, allowing for extended rides without frequent recharges. For example, a 500Wh battery generally offers more range than a 300Wh battery under similar conditions.
Range, the distance an e-bike can travel on a single charge, depends on several factors including battery capacity, motor efficiency, rider weight, terrain, and riding style. Manufacturers often provide estimated ranges, but real-world performance can vary. Consider your typical riding conditions and distances to determine the appropriate battery capacity for your needs.
Additionally, advanced features like battery management systems (BMS) help optimize power usage and extend battery life, enhancing overall range. By carefully evaluating these aspects, you can select an electric bike with the right battery capacity and range to meet your specific requirements.
Battery Technology and Longevity: What Sets the Best Apart:
Battery technology and longevity are key differentiators among electric bikes, significantly affecting performance and value. Lithium-ion batteries dominate the market due to their high energy density, lightweight, and long lifespan. Among these, advanced variations like lithium iron phosphate (LiFePO4) and lithium polymer (LiPo) offer even better stability, safety, and efficiency.
Battery management systems (BMS) play a crucial role in extending battery life. These systems monitor and regulate the battery’s charge and discharge cycles, preventing overcharging and overheating, which can degrade the battery over time. E-bikes with sophisticated BMS ensure consistent performance and longer battery life.
The best batteries also feature fast-charging capabilities, reducing downtime and increasing convenience. Modular battery designs, allowing for easy removal and replacement, enhance flexibility and longevity by enabling users to carry spare batteries for extended range.
In summary, superior battery technology combines high energy density, advanced management systems, and user-friendly features, ensuring longer life and reliable performance, setting the best e-bike batteries apart from the rest.
